JOB SUMMARY
Responsible for managing the delivery of H&R Block business applications as well as managing ongoing deployments of business applications and collaborating on medium- and long-term IT multi-integration projects. Initiating, planning, executing and controlling projects involving multiple people, processes and technology components. Lead integration projects to deliver customer tax return flows to production. Manage 10+ IT teams to integrate the user flow from an external software into the various HR Block tax flows across multiple tax platforms. Work with the Program team and integrated IT teams to identify risks, blockers and issues and determine solutions to help deliver on time and on budget. Provide constant clear communication and coordinate all teams to understand their roles, workload, dependencies, and deadlines for delivery. Lead the delivery of a pilot software for the redesign of the HR Block clients online experience. Liaise with the Product team and IT teams to define, build and deliver a pilot for our users online experience. Work with the Product owners, UX, Dev (onshore and offshore) and Program team to understand the requirements, gain buy in for the program, communicate the workload and duties to the IT team and facilitate the delivery of the pilot. Define new process and procedures for the feature team, help on-board the new offshore and onshore resources and plan, execute and deliver in an agile manner. Perform scrum master duties to define and groom new user stories based on the UX designs and continue to facilitate the dev team to deliver the requirements on time and as documented. Manage the roll out of an internal solution for H&R Block tax professionals to work from anywhere. Manage the setup and rollout of software pods, create and update documentation for tax pros and the help center to troubleshoot issues. Coordinate the creation, testing and deployment of the builds and work with the help center. Train their team for troubleshooting and support to reduce escalations. Manage the ongoing deployments for Blockworks Work from Anywhere and Practice in the Cloud software to production, including working with the integrated teams to prep/task and deploy the builds seamlessly through tax season. Lead the project to migrate and automate the BlockWorks deployment process through FiDo. Work with the Build, Infrastructure, Dev and QA teams to automate the build process and deploy through Fido to all production offices for current and prior year BlockWorks builds. Drive multiple Dev Ops process and practices, defining and rolling out to IT and Product teams cross functionally.
QUALIFICATIONS
Bachelor's degree or equivalent in Computer Science, IT or a related field.
Three years of business analysis experience in a tax preparation environment to include:
End-to-end Project Management (E2E PM) for the software development life cycle (SDLC);
Prepare process and data models;
Coordinate pilots, test activities and report findings;
SCRUM/Agile methodologies with enterprise-level application development projects;
Agile ceremonies and planning to facilitate Agile delivery;
Agile management (HP ALM or Microsoft Azure DevOps (ADO)) and collaboration tools (Microsoft Teams or Skype for Business); and
Silverlight UI framework.
One year of which must include:
Backend configuration and security of Azure DevOps;
DevOps CI/CD methodologies and transformation to a DevOps model;
MS Visio;
Roadmap software (Aha!);
Project collaboration tools (Miro boards);
Migrate and train teams on new software/processes; and
Manage multiple projects and programs.
